Wow is all I can say. I dropped my series 60 block off to have it machined after my local shop closed up unexpectedly. They did the engine to spec, but before I left when I dropped it off I gave a specific request that I wanted to counterbores cut to leave the liners .004-.005 above the deck. The spec is .0005-.003, our experience in building horsepower in these engines is that .004-.005 is better for the additional fuel and air added to the cylinders. Neil called me AFTER all the work was done to ask questions about my request, I told him I gave him incorrect specs for an older engine, then he proceeded to tell me he cut them for .003-.004 above, certainly not what I requested. Last time I checked, you call the customer BEFORE you do the work if he/she has requests. If they are out of the normal then you can discuss that, you don't do the work and then tell them you did it the way they wanted. When I picked the block up, due to a bad experience with another machine shop I wanted to double check the liner protrusion, Neil and Luke both flew off the handle. I was cussed at and called names I can't repeat on google, in Neil's words, "keep the F-ckin head in the pickup, cause we ain't doing it!" I had a cylinder head that needed done also and was dropping it off. Their work is good and was done way ahead of the suggested time frame, but their public relations suck.
